Experiments and Modeling of Mass Transport Phenomena in SiGe Devices
Abstract
Recent experiments and continuum modeling work on dopant diffusion and segregation, Si-Ge interdiffusion, and defect engineering in SiGe material systems are reviewed. Doping impact on Ge thin film quality and interdiffusion is also discussed. These are relevant to SiGe-based semiconductor devices including SiGe hetero-junction bipolar transistors, metal-oxidesemiconductor field-effect transistors, and Ge-on-Si based photonic devices.
